Received notice we will receive our telework stipend. It’s going to be the $50/$25 that the State originally offered. It will be retroactive to 10/1/21. Right. For the units that bargained it, along with excluded employees, this is true. For the units that didn’t bargain it, like SEIU, no stipend for them as of yet.

To be fair the unit 2 special salary adjustment was bargained for in exchange of the $260 health supplement that we have had since 2019. And I am fairly sure we got a lower GSI to make it seem like we were getting an SSA in exchange for the health supplement (the bargaining units without health supplements got larger GSIs). The cost depends on how many people are on your insurance and what the state contribution is. For 2023 if you're on the 80-80 formula and it's only you, I think you'll be out of pocket $77/month for PERS Gold.
